Bryden Nicholas (born 10 March 1989 in Tauranga) is: a New Zealand-Cook Islander slalom canoeist who has competed at the: international level since 2005.

He finished in 21st place in the——K1 event at the 2016 Summer Olympics in Rio de Janeiro.

He represented New Zealand until 2010. Since 2011 he has been representing Cook Islands like his sister Ella.
